This will be enough to play the game in english.
How to use?
1. Download DSlazy (it's in GBAtemp's downloads).
2. Unpack the roms.
3. Go to the Data folder, then the Text folder.
4. Select FR or NL (I did NL, so maybe you should just use that one).
5. Copy and paste the translation I provided in this post in the right .txt file.
6. Save and quit it.
7. Pack the rom.
8. Enjoy this game in english!

(I haven't tested it, but it should work).

EEragon said:
I'll translate it into perfect English if someone will tell me how you can open a rom file and see what's in there.
To open it up, you can run DSlazy or a similar program, choose the rom, and choose 'unpack'. The text files will be in the NDS_UNPACK\data\Text directory (French in FR, Dutch in NL.)

Choose one of those directories and edit the text files inside, then use DSlazy or whatever to repack it.
